Vishal Mega Mart Limited IPO: Issue Price, Listing Gain and Share Price Now
Vishal Mega Mart Limited listed on 18-Dec-2024 at ₹111.95 against an issue price of ₹78 , a listing gain of +43.53%. It last traded at ₹102.6. This page is the record of that issue and what has happened to it since — reported figures only.
Vishal Mega Mart Limited IPO: listing gain and return since
| Measure | Value |
|---|---|
| Issue price | ₹78 |
| Listing price (listing-day close) | ₹111.95 |
| Listing gain | +43.53% |
| Price now | ₹102.6 |
| Change from issue price | +31.54% |
| Change from listing-day close | -8.35% |
The two changes above answer different questions and are routinely opposite in sign. The change from the issue price is what an allottee has made. The change from the listing-day close is what somebody who bought on the first day has made.
Vishal Mega Mart Limited IPO details
| Issue term | Detail |
|---|---|
| Issue price (upper band) | ₹78 |
| Issue size | ₹8,000 Cr |
| Offer for sale | ₹8,000 Cr |
| Issue opened | 11-Dec-2024 |
| Issue closed | 13-Dec-2024 |
| Listed on | 18-Dec-2024 |
| Exchange | BSE, NSE |
| Segment | Mainboard |
| Lead managers | Kotak Mahindra Capital (left lead) |
How the Vishal Mega Mart Limited IPO was subscribed
| Category | Subscription |
|---|---|
| QIB | 85.11x |
| NII | 15.01x |
| Retail | 2.43x |
| Total | 28.75x |
